Etisal upgrade – ITP Technology
|
|
|
|
GCC services industry player Riadaa has revamped its
CRM-focused Etisal business unit, deploying Altitude Software’s Unified Customer
Interaction (uCI) suite to manage large numbers of queries more effectively.
|
|
|
|
|
Riadaa set up International Contact Company (Etisal)
in September 2004, with the unit specializing in the provision of call centre outsourcing
services to sectors including financial institutions, manufacturers and retailers.
Etisal’s Jeddah-based contact centre is equipped to host 100 agents with expansion
capabilities of up to 400 seats.
|
|
|
|
|
Altitude claims that since the uCI suite was deployed
in November 2004, Riadaa has experienced a 60% reduction of waiting times, a boost
in first call resolution rates from 42% to 89%, and a significant decrease in call
abandonment levels from 29% to under 4%
|
|
|
|
|
“The call centre outsourcing unit allows us to meet
our clients´ CRM requirements in all areas, and from this strong platform our objective
is to grow rapidly and be one of the leading outsourcers in the GCC region,” says
Ahmed Moharrak, Etisal’s general manager.
|
|
|
|
|
“We constantly strive to deliver world-class service
and we knew Altitude’s technology was the clear choice to help us maintain that
level of service,” says Mohamed Eissa, Etisal Assistant General Manager. “The solution
had to be flexible and modular, enabling us to easily and cost-effectively add additional
functionality, such as web chat and web collaboration, as our needs evolve,” he
adds.
|
|
|
|
|
The Jeddah-based CRM outsourcer chose Altitude Software
due to its flexibility in modifying front office applications, as it had proved
difficult to make changes and to have agents re-trained. The company also pulled
out the CTI (computer telephony integration) feature that intelligently manages
interactions by integrating data from switches and computers and the pre-integrated
IVR (interactive voice response) module, which enables customer self service via
voice menus and touch-tone phone controls, as important.
|
|
|
|
|
Additionally the open design, which supports all major
PABXs and a wide range of third-party solutions, including the Etisal Cisco IP switch
and ebusiness applications, such as Siebel or SAP, was seen to be crucial.
